Ascii Art

Ascii art is a way of designing pictures using a computer and keyboard


symbols.

It can range from very simple pictures to some incredibly complex pieces of
work.

Task 1
Follow this simple tutorial to create an ascii art bunny

Open Notepad>>>>

1. Make two pairs of parenthesis right next to each other, and


then move to the next line. ()()

2. Make two underlines, a parenthesis, an equal sign, an underlined


quotation mark, an equals sign, another parenthesis, and two more
underlines, like this: __(="=)__

3. Move to the next line.

4. Make a left parenthesis, a space, a period, another space, and a right


parenthesis, like this: ( . )

5. Move to the next line.

6. Type a lower case c, two left parentheses, a quotation mark, a right and
left parentheses, a quotation mark, and one last right parenthesis, like this:
(")(")

7. Line up each line. The finished bunny should look like the image above
